Meet Coach Elliott
Coach Bill Elliott is a cornerstone of Celina ISD athletics, serving as both Athletic Director and Head Football Coach at Celina High School. With over three decades of dedication to the Bobcats, he has been instrumental in shaping the school's athletic excellence and fostering a culture of integrity and perseverance.
A 1986 graduate of Pilot Point High School, Elliott played under legendary coaches G.A. Moore Jr. and Butch Ford. He continued his football journey at Texas Christian University, graduating in 1990 after four years as a Horned Frog. In 1993, he joined the Celina coaching staff, and by 2012, he ascended to the role of head coach. Under his leadership, the Bobcats have consistently been contenders, culminating in a perfect 16-0 season and a 4A Division I state championship in 2024 .
Elliott's commitment to developing young men extends beyond the football field. He emphasizes core values such as integrity, excellence, empathy, and grit, guiding his players to become responsible and respectful individuals . This holistic approach to coaching has impacted thousands of student-athletes throughout his tenure.
In recognition of his outstanding contributions, Coach Elliott was honored with the G.A. Moore Coach of the Year award in 2025 . His enduring legacy at Celina High School is marked by a steadfast commitment to excellence, both on and off the field.
